M95P16-I Series
The M95P16-I and M95P16-E (hereinafter referred to complessively as M95P16) are manufactured with ST's advanced proprietary NVM technology. They offer byte flexibility, page alterability, high page cycling performance, and ultra low power consumption, equivalent to that of EEPROM technology.
These devices are a 16-Mbit SPI page EEPROM, organized as 4096 programmable pages of 512 bytes each, accessed through an SPI bus, with high-performance dual- and quad-SPI outputs.
